About the Role We're looking for an experienced Equity Administration Manager to oversee the company's global equity programs and ensure operational excellence, compliance, and scalability as we continue to grow. This role will sit within the Finance organization and partner closely with Legal, People, and external vendors to manage all aspects of our equity lifecycle from issuance and reporting to governance and employee education.

You'll serve as the subject matter expert on all things related to stock administration, with ownership of processes that support our equity platform, financial reporting, and employee experience.

What You'll Do Own daily administration of the company's equity plans, including stock option grants, RSUs, exercises, repurchases, and cancellations.

Partner with People Operations to support onboarding, offboarding, and employee communications related to equity.

Maintain accuracy and integrity of data in the equity management system (e.g., Carta).

Coordinate with external auditors, tax advisors, and legal counsel on equity-related matters.

Support employee education around equity to enhance understanding and engagement. Respond to incoming requests and coordinate cross-functionally to answer employee questions.

What You Need 6–8 years of progressive experience in equity administration, ideally at least 2 years in a manager-level or lead role.

Deep expertise in equity management platforms (Shareworks preferred) and familiarity with GAAP accounting for equity compensation.

Strong understanding of U.S. tax and securities regulations related to equity compensation (including 409A, taxation on equity).

High attention to detail, analytical rigor, and process orientation.

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ate across Finance, Legal, and People teams.

Nice-to-Haves Experience in a pre-IPO or hyper-growth tech company environment.

Familiarity with global equity programs and expansion outside of the US (ESPP, RSU)
